A member asked:

Can i have warts because of my lack of immune system?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Possible/unlikely: Certainly people with a weakened immune system (for example pt with HIV) are more likely to contract opportunistic infections with viruses and parasites. However, warts are very common even in healthy 17 y/o. You are probably very healthy and have warts because 10% or more of healthy teenagers have warts.
